Transaction 89026f9678942eb95432de8409293a27af3a4137fd27d7718b4e4fbe08521382
1 Input
1 Output
-
89026f9678942eb95432de8409293a27af3a4137fd27d7718b4e4fbe08521382:0
- value
- 24391
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c67862cc0298e6b368e2be9b59dd129b2ffed2d
- address
- bc1qm3ncvtxq9x8xkd5w905mt8w39xe0lmfdya7jn4